Fundamentos de Algoritmos de IA en Java: Búsqueda, Optimización y Juegos — LearnFlat

Fundamentos de Algoritmos de IA en Java: Búsqueda, Optimización y Juegos

Aprende a implementar algoritmos esenciales de búsqueda, optimización y juegos desde cero utilizando Java limpio y moderno.

4.5 (847) ⏱ 35 min 📚 12 lecciones 🎧 Versión en audio

Sobre este curso

Comprender cómo las computadoras resuelven problemas complejos de búsqueda de caminos, optimización y toma de decisiones estratégicas es la piedra angular de la inteligencia artificial. Este curso basado en texto te guía a través de los conceptos centrales de los algoritmos de IA, demostrando cómo implementarlos paso a paso usando Java. Pasarás de escribir programas básicos a crear algoritmos inteligentes que puedan navegar laberintos, optimizar funciones complejas y jugar juegos clásicos. Al estudiar explicaciones escritas claras y examinar fragmentos de código estructurados, obtendrás una comprensión profunda e intuitiva de cómo funciona la IA clásica. Lo que aprenderás: - Comprender la teoría fundamental de grafos e implementar algoritmos de búsqueda clásicos como Búsqueda en Anchura (BFS) y Búsqueda en Profundidad (DFS). - Aplicar técnicas de búsqueda heurística utilizando el algoritmo A* para resolver problemas de búsqueda de caminos y navegación de manera eficiente. - Explorar métodos de optimización metaheurística, incluyendo Recocido Simulado y Algoritmos Genéticos, para encontrar soluciones a desafíos combinatorios complejos. - Configurar la Optimización por Enjambre de Partículas para simular inteligencia colectiva y resolver problemas de optimización continua. - Construir motores de juego utilizando el algoritmo Minimax mejorado con poda alfa-beta para la toma de decisiones estratégicas. - Practicar estándares de codificación limpia utilizando características modernas de Java como records e inferencia de tipo de variable local para escribir implementaciones de algoritmos legibles. El viaje comienza con definiciones fundamentales de grafos, estados y espacios de búsqueda, asegurando que tengas una base conceptual sólida. A partir de ahí, progresarás a través de módulos escritos estructurados, pasando de la búsqueda de caminos básica a técnicas de optimización avanzadas y árboles de juego interactivos. Este curso está diseñado para programadores que son nuevos en la inteligencia artificial y desean comprender la mecánica detrás de los algoritmos clásicos de búsqueda y optimización. Se recomienda una familiaridad básica con la sintaxis de Java, pero no se requiere experiencia previa en IA o matemáticas avanzadas. Comienza a leer hoy mismo para desbloquear los algoritmos fundamentales que impulsan los sistemas inteligentes modernos.

Lo que obtendrás

  • 📜 Certificado de finalización
    Añádelo a tu perfil de LinkedIn
  • 💬 Tutor AI personal
    ¿Atascado en una lección? Pregúntale a tu tutor integrado lo que quieras, cuando quieras.
  • 🎧 Versión en audio incluida
    Aprende en cualquier momento, sin pantalla
  • ♾️ Acceso de por vida
    Vuelve cuando quieras, sin caducidad
  • 📱 Teléfono o computadora
    Funciona en cualquier dispositivo
  • 💸 Reembolso de 14 días
    Sin preguntas
  • Breve y enfocado
    35 min de contenido práctico

Reseñas (5)

Valeria Reyes MX
★ 3 · 2025-08-15T14:25:54+00:00

Me pareció bastante informativo. La estructura era lógica, aunque algunos de los temas más avanzados podrían haberse beneficiado de ejemplos más detallados.

Nikolai Ivanov BG Estudiante verificado
★ 5 · 2025-08-13T22:46:54+00:00

Una buena introducción. La estructura era en su mayoría clara, pero me gustaría que hubiera algunos ejemplos más del mundo real.

Despina Nikolaidou GR
★ 5 · 2025-04-29T16:00:54+00:00

Curso: Excel 2013 - Advanced (Español) Translated by El ritmo era perfecto, y los ejemplos realmente solidificaron los conceptos.

อดิศักดิ์ ชัยชนะ TH Estudiante verificado
★ 3 · 2025-01-23T09:00:54+00:00

Curso: Los ejemplos fueron en su mayoría útiles. Puede necesitar práctica adicional en otro lugar para el dominio.

حسن DZ Estudiante verificado
★ 5 · 2024-12-28T22:19:54+00:00

Es un curso sólido. La estructura es lógica y la mayoría de los ejemplos fueron útiles.Podría usar algunos escenarios más del mundo real.

Escribir una reseña

Te pediremos iniciar sesión después de enviar — tu borrador se guarda.

Otros también tomaron

Preguntas frecuentes

¿Qué necesito para tomar este curso? +

Solo un teléfono o computadora con internet. Sin instalaciones ni hardware especial.

¿Cómo pago? +

Con tarjeta a través de Stripe. No almacenamos datos de tarjeta — Stripe los gestiona de forma segura.

¿Puedo obtener un reembolso? +

Sí — reembolso completo en 14 días, sin preguntas.

¿Por cuánto tiempo tendré acceso? +

Para siempre. Una vez comprado, el curso es tuyo para revisarlo cuando quieras.

¿Obtendré un certificado? +

Sí. Al finalizar recibirás un certificado que puedes añadir a tu perfil de LinkedIn.

Diseñado para profesionales en
Tecnología Diseño Finanzas Marketing Salud Educación Hostelería Manufactura